Both have their origin in Japan.
Manga [1] is - to a certain extent - equavalent to the Western "comic book" [2] format, while anime [3] is equavalent to the Western "animatied cartoon" [4] format.

As with their Western counterparts, a story can start out as either manga or anime, then be "translated" to the other medium: the popular anime "Ghost in the Shell" [5] is a good example of manga-to-anime (which is by far the most common direction) and ".hack" [6] is a fair example of the reverse, though it was also a videogame.

In making a comparison between the Western and Eastern, I must point out that the market (and therefore social standing) of "manga" and "anime" vs. "cartoons" and "comic books" is vastly different: in Japan, they are more often - though not always - marketed and purchased by a more adult population, whereas is the West - with some exceptions ("Maus" [7] and the Sandman series [8] being good examples) - the market for these types of publications are mostly 8-16 year old childern. This is not to say that more "adult-oriented" animations and comic books do not exist in the West (see "Fritz the Cat" [9] for examples of both), just that they are the exception, not the rule, whereas in Japan, such "adult-oriented" materials are much more common and accessable. Also, the themes of manga and anime are often much more adult, in both style and execution, than those of comparable Western publications.

Manga is the raw material of what the anime is supposed to be. It is like a comic in a magazine and is usually more explicit than the anime.
also the manga doesn't contain filler episodes (the animes usually do) which stray from the plot so that it gives the maga writter more time to add onto the series.

The anime is usually two manga chapters put into one episode. Like i said they normally contain fillers. As well they usually draw out conversation and battles a little more. There is far less swearing, the clothing of charactes may be altered for a mroe general audience as well.

and most basically of all manga is like a comic strip, and anime is animated :D

Manga are comics and often in black and white form.
Anime is the animated form of the manga.
Most of the cases the anime is based off the manga (DBZ, One Piece, etc) and follow it with some minor changes.
Some special cases like pokemon it starts off as an anime and then a manga is produced.
